ABSTRACT

Azanza garckeana is a plant with reported medicinal properties found in the northern part of Nigeria. This study was aimed at comparing the bioactive compounds present in the hexane seeds and roots extracts of Azanza garckeana using the gas chromatography-mass spectrometry (GC-MS) technique. The total ion chromatogram (TIC) of the seed and roots revealed the presence of 19 and 11 bioactive compounds in the seeds and roots respectively.The compound hexadecanoic acid, ethyl ester was found to be the highest in the hexane seed extract of Azanza garckeana with 15.01 % in content, with reported anti-glycemic and antioxidant biological activities, whileOctadecanoic acid was found to be the highest in the hexane root extract with 21.13 % in content, with Antimicriobal activity. 2-Pyrrolidinone, 1-methyl was the least in both the seed and root extracts with 0.19 % content in the seed and 0.32 % in content in the root. 2- Pyrrolidinone, 1-methylis used in the treatment of Myeloma.The compounds 2-pyrrolidinone, 1- methyl, n-hexadecanoic acid, and Linoleic acid ethyl ester were identified in both the hexane seeds and root extracts, of which n-Hexadecanoic acid have been reported to possess antioxidant, Hypocholesterolemia, nematicide, pesticide, antiandrogenic, flavor, Hemolytic, 5-Alpha reductase inhibitor activities, while Linoleic acid ethyl ester reported to have anti-inflammatory activity.A total of 30 bioactive compounds were identified in the seed and roots extracts.A total of twelve (12) bioactive compounds with reported biological activities were identified in the seeds, these compounds include: 2-Pyrrolidinone, 1-methyl-, Hexadecanoic acid, methyl ester, nhexadecenoic, 9,12-Octadecadienoic acid, methyl ester, Linoleic acid ethyl ester, Ethyl Oleate, 9-Octadecenoic acid (Z)-, methyl ester, Methyl stearate, Octadecanoic acid, ethyl ester, 2- Methyl-Z, Z-3,13-octadecadienoic, Floxuridine and Hexadecanoic acid, 2-hydroxy-1- hydroxymethyl) ethyl ester. Their biological activity ranges from myeloma treatment to antioxidant, anticarcinogenic, anti-inflammatory, antifungal, hypocholesterolemic, antiandrogenic, and insecticide activities, whilea total of 5 bioactive compounds with reported viii biological activities were identified in the roots. These compounds include; octadecanoic acid, nhexadecenoic acid, linoleic acid ethyl ester, 9,12- octadecadienoic acid (Z, Z) methyl ester, and oleic acid. Their reported activities include; antimicrobial activity, anti-inflammatory, Antioxidant, 5-Alpha reductase inhibitor, potent mosquito larvicideand anticancer. The seeds and roots of Azanza garckeana are rich in bioactive compounds, with hexane seed extract containing a larger amount of bioactive compounds in content compared to that of the root extract.
